Career Path

In the UK, there is a growing demand for professionals specializing in child emotional health. Let's dive into a 3D pie chart showcasing the job market trends for these roles, revealing a promising landscape for those interested in this rewarding field. 1. **Child Counselor (35%)** – With a focus on talk therapy, these professionals help children navigate complex emotions and situations. As mental health awareness increases, so does the demand for skilled child counselors. 2. **Child Psychologist (25%)** – These experts study children's behavior and mental development, using scientific methods to understand and address various disorders. With more emphasis on child emotional health, the need for child psychologists is on the rise. 3. **Special Education Needs Coordinator (SENCO) (20%)** – SENCOs work within educational institutions to support children with special educational needs, ensuring their well-being and academic success. As inclusion becomes a priority, the call for SENCOs is growing. 4. **Pediatric Nurse (10%)** – Pediatric nurses specialize in caring for young patients, often addressing emotional needs alongside physical health concerns. With a comprehensive approach to pediatric care, these professionals play a crucial role in child emotional health. 5. **Child Therapist (10%)** – Combining various techniques, child therapists help children overcome emotional challenges, such as trauma or anxiety. As the need for mental health resources expands, so does the demand for child therapists.
